WebHowever, denied pregnancy makes up only a proportion of all unknown pregnancies. Epidemiology. The recent scientific research shows that 1 in 475 pregnancies can classify as a cryptic pregnancy, where pregnancy isn't discovered until at least 20 weeks. 1 in 7,225 pregnancies are unknown at the time the mother gives birth. WebJun 6, 2024 · The only way to tell if this was your case is to have tests done on the tissue from your miscarried pregnancy. If it is shown that there were genetic problems then you can also try to have tests done on your future children's DNA as they are born. You can have these tests done at the same time or later in a future pregnancy. WebNov 11, 2024 · There are plenty of potential symptoms that clue women in to the fact they might be pregnant. Morning sickness, lack of periods, tender boobs and a bump, to name a few. But for some women, those typical cues don’t always happen, so often the first time they realise they are pregnant is when they actually give birth.
